Supported metrics for Microsoft.ManagedNetworkFabric/networkFabricControllers

The following table lists the metrics available for the Microsoft.ManagedNetworkFabric/networkFabricControllers resource type.

Table headings

Metric - The metric display name as it appears in the Azure portal. Name in Rest API - Metric name as referred to in the REST API. Unit - Unit of measure. Aggregation - The default aggregation type. Valid values: Average, Minimum, Maximum, Total, Count. Dimensions - Dimensions available for the metric. Time Grains - Intervals at which the metric is sampled. For example, PT1M indicates that the metric is sampled every minute, PT30M every 30 minutes, PT1H every hour, and so on. DS Export- Whether the metric is exportable to Azure Monitor Logs via Diagnostic Settings.

For information on exporting metrics, see - Create diagnostic settings in Azure Monitor.

For information on metric retention, see Azure Monitor Metrics overview.

Category: Health

Metric Name in REST API Unit Aggregation Dimensions Time Grains DS Export
NFC Envoy Restarts

Container restart count for Envoy.
kube_pod_container_status_restarts_total_envoy Count Count, Average, Minimum, Maximum, Total (Sum) nfcClusterRole, container PT1M No
NFC Geneva Monitoring Infra Restarts

Container restart count for Geneva Monitoring Infra.
kube_pod_container_status_restarts_total_geneva_monitoringinfra Count Count, Average, Minimum, Maximum, Total (Sum) nfcClusterRole, container PT1M No
NFC gNMI Gateway Restarts

Container restart count for gNMI Gateway.
kube_pod_container_status_restarts_total_gnmigw Count Count, Average, Minimum, Maximum, Total (Sum) nfcClusterRole, container PT1M No
NFC NTP Restarts

Container restart count for NTP.
kube_pod_container_status_restarts_total_ntp Count Count, Average, Minimum, Maximum, Total (Sum) nfcClusterRole, container PT1M No
NFC Operator Restarts

Container restart count for Operator.
kube_pod_container_status_restarts_total_operator Count Count, Average, Minimum, Maximum, Total (Sum) nfcClusterRole, container PT1M No
NFC Redis Restarts

Container restart count for Redis.
kube_pod_container_status_restarts_total_redis Count Count, Average, Minimum, Maximum, Total (Sum) nfcClusterRole, container PT1M No
NFC XDS Restarts

Container restart count for XDS.
kube_pod_container_status_restarts_total_xds Count Count, Average, Minimum, Maximum, Total (Sum) nfcClusterRole, container PT1M No
NFC ZooKeeper Restarts

Container restart count for ZooKeeper.
kube_pod_container_status_restarts_total_zk Count Count, Average, Minimum, Maximum, Total (Sum) nfcClusterRole, container PT1M No
NFC Envoy Availability

Composite health state for the Envoy deployments. 1=Healthy, 2=Degraded, 3=Unhealthy.
nfc_service_replica_state_envoy Count Average, Minimum, Maximum nfcClusterRole, deployment PT1M No
NFC Geneva Monitoring Infra Availability

Composite health state for the Geneva Monitoring Infra deployment. 1=Healthy, 2=Degraded, 3=Unhealthy.
nfc_service_replica_state_geneva_monitoringinfra Count Average, Minimum, Maximum nfcClusterRole, deployment PT1M No
NFC gNMI Gateway Availability

Composite health state for the gNMI Gateway deployment. 1=Healthy, 2=Degraded, 3=Unhealthy.
nfc_service_replica_state_gnmigw Count Average, Minimum, Maximum nfcClusterRole, deployment PT1M No
NFC Operator Availability

Composite health state for the NFA Operator. 1=Healthy, 2=Degraded, 3=Unhealthy.
nfc_service_replica_state_operator Count Average, Minimum, Maximum nfcClusterRole, deployment PT1M No
NFC XDS Availability

Composite health state for the XDS deployment. 1=Healthy, 2=Degraded, 3=Unhealthy.
nfc_service_replica_state_xds Count Average, Minimum, Maximum nfcClusterRole, deployment PT1M No
NFC NTP Availability

Composite health state for NTP. 1=Healthy, 2=Degraded, 3=Unhealthy.
nfc_services_statefulset_status_ntp Count Average, Minimum, Maximum nfcClusterRole, statefulset PT1M No
NFC Redis Availability

Composite health state for Redis. 1=Healthy, 2=Degraded, 3=Unhealthy.
nfc_services_statefulset_status_redis Count Average, Minimum, Maximum nfcClusterRole, statefulset PT1M No
NFC ZooKeeper Availability

Composite health state for ZooKeeper. 1=Healthy, 2=Degraded, 3=Unhealthy.
nfc_services_statefulset_status_zk Count Average, Minimum, Maximum nfcClusterRole, statefulset PT1M No

Next steps